H.RES.650: Provid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 1852) to modernize and update the National Housing Act and enable the Federal Housing Administration to use risk-based pricing to more effectively reach underserved borrowers, and for other purposes.
About This Bill
- This bill was introduced in the 110th Congress
- This bill is primarily about congress
- Introduced Sept. 17, 2007
- Latest Major Action Sept. 18, 2007
Bill Sponsor
Bill Summary
Sets forth the rule for consideration of H.R. 1852 (Expanding American Homeownership Act of 2007).
(Source: Library of Congress)
Bill Actions
Date | Description |
---|---|
The House Committee on Rules reported an original measure, H. Rept. 110-330, by Ms. Matsui.
|
|
Rule provides for consideration of H.R. 1852 with 1 hour of general debate. Previous question shall be considered as ordered without intervening motions except motion to recommit with or without instructions. Measure will be considered read. A specified amendment is in order.
|
|
Placed on the House Calendar, Calendar No. 115.
|
|
Considered as privileged matter.
|
|
DEBATE - The House proceeded with one hour of debate on H. Res. 650.
|
|
On ordering the previous question Agreed to by the Yeas and Nays: 226 - 191 (Roll no. 871).
|
|
On agreeing to the resolution Agreed to by recorded vote: 227 - 190 (Roll no. 872).
|
|
Motion to reconsider laid on the table Agreed to without objection.
